GE Transportation Investor Relations Manager Salary

The average GE Transportation Investor Relations Manager earns an estimated $98,724 annually. GE Transportation's Investor Relations Manager compensation is $11,420 more than the US average for a Investor Relations Manager.

The Communications Department at GE Transportation earns $42,734 more on average than the Engineering Department.
